What Are the Different Types of Scholarships at Lewis University?



Lewis University offers a variety of scholarships to meet the needs of its students. The following are some of the different types of scholarships available at Lewis University.

First, there are merit-based scholarships. These scholarships are awarded to students who demonstrate academic excellence and leadership. Merit-based scholarships are typically awarded based on the student’s GPA, test scores, and other achievements.

Second, there are need-based scholarships. These scholarships are awarded to students who demonstrate financial need. Need-based scholarships are typically awarded based on the student’s family income, assets, and other financial factors.

Third, there are athletic scholarships. These scholarships are awarded to students who demonstrate athletic excellence. Athletic scholarships are typically awarded based on the student’s athletic performance and achievements.

Fourth, there are departmental scholarships. These scholarships are awarded to students who demonstrate excellence in a particular field of study. Departmental scholarships are typically awarded based on the student’s academic performance and achievements in a particular field of study.

Lastly, there are other types of scholarships. These scholarships are awarded to students who demonstrate a commitment to their education and/or community.

What Are the Application Process for Scholarships at Lewis University?



The application process for scholarships at Lewis University varies by scholarship. Most scholarships require students to fill out an online application, which can be found on the university’s website. After submitting the online application, the student must provide the necessary supporting documents, such as transcripts and letters of recommendation. The student must also provide proof of financial need, if applicable.

Once the student has submitted all the necessary documents, the scholarship committee will review the application and make a decision. The student will be notified of the scholarship committee’s decision by email or letter.
